THTR 385 - Theatre Seminar A capstone course that synthesizes research, reading, and production techniques. Topic area may be defined by a genre, an historical period, the works of an individual or group of artists, or other similar limits. Within the parameters of the topic area, students will undertake a series of research activities and projects. The course culminates in the production of a group of one act plays and a public presentation of research findings, projects, or papers. Course instructor and department faculty will determine the student’s production area assignment.
Credit(s): 4 Prerequisite(s): Completion of all other courses in “Required Departmental Core” for Theatre Arts Major and senior standing, or permission of instructor General Education Designations: Collaborative Leadership, Disciplinary Speaking Offered: every spring.
